Pineda Director <br /> <br /> <br /> <br /> <br /> <br /> <br /> <br />Dear Mr. Thompson <br />The Division has completed its review of the 2012 Annual Reclamation Report (ARR) for the Golden <br />Eagle Mine, received on February 14, 2013. The Division finds the report in compliance with Rule 2.04.13. <br /> The New Elk Mine is currently in Temporary Cessation, but is expected to resume production within a few months. A total of 162.98 acres have been disturbed, with 35.14 acres of the total phase I bond <br />released. No additional acres were disturbed and no additional reclamation occurred during 2012. <br />Considerable activity occurred at the site during 2012, but all projects were within the existing disturbance. <br /> <br />Bi-weekly inspections of the site were used to monitor noxious weeds and erosion damage of reclaimed areas. <br />No rills and gullies were identified. <br />Noxious weeds, including Canadian thistle and hounds-tongue, were controlled by hand-spraying the infested area with Tordon. <br /> Sincerely, <br /> <br />Leigh Simmons Environmental Protection Specialist <br />Ron Thompson New Elk Coal Company, LLC <br />12250 Highway 12 Weston, CO 81091 <br /> <br /> <br />February 14, 2013 <br />Re: New Elk Mine, Permit C-1981-012 <br /> 2012 Annual Reclamation Report Review
